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What types of pool liners do suppliers typically offer?

Most pool liner suppliers offer a variety of options, including vinyl liners, fiberglass liners, and custom-designed liners. You can choose from different thicknesses, colors, and patterns to match your pool’s aesthetic. Additionally, many suppliers provide options for both above-ground and in-ground pools.

How do I choose the right pool liner supplier?

When selecting a pool liner supplier, consider factors like reputation, product quality, customer service, and pricing. Reading reviews and asking for recommendations can help. It’s also beneficial to check if they offer installation services or support, as this can simplify the process for you.

What is the average lifespan of a pool liner?

The lifespan of a pool liner typically ranges from 5 to 15 years, depending on the material, maintenance, and environmental factors. Vinyl liners may last around 10 years, while fiberglass options can last longer. Regular cleaning and proper care can help extend their lifespan.

Are custom pool liners more expensive than standard ones?

Yes, custom pool liners usually cost more than standard options due to the additional design work and materials involved. However, they can provide a unique look that perfectly fits your pool’s shape and style. It’s worth considering your budget and preferences when making this choice.

How do I maintain my pool liner?

To maintain your pool liner, regularly check and balance the water chemistry, clean the liner to prevent algae growth, and inspect for any tears or damage. Avoid using harsh chemicals and sharp objects near the liner. Proper maintenance will help prolong its life and keep your pool looking great.
